Посоветуйте pdf-читалку

dangerr

а то xpdf не умеет показывать страницы в "continuous view" (это так в djview4 называется) и с именами файлов на русском не дружит несмотря на utf8-локаль. Да и вообще мне интерфейс у него не нравится.

lubanj

acrobat reader? ...

egoregor

evince?

dangerr

boolean / # emerge -s acrobat
Searching...
[ Results for search key : acrobat ]
[ Applications found : 0 ]

нету такого...

dangerr

boolean / # emerge -pv evince

These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ild N ] sys-apps/dbus-1.2.3-r1 USE="X -debug -doc (-selinux)" 1,528 kB
[ebuild N ] app-text/build-docbook-catalog-1.4 3 kB
[ebuild N ] dev-perl/XML-NamespaceSupport-1.09 8 kB
[ebuild N ] gnome-base/orbit-2.14.13 USE="-debug -doc" 723 kB
[ebuild N ] perl-core/Storable-2.18 174 kB
[ebuild N ] perl-core/Test-Simple-0.80 80 kB
[ebuild N ] gnome-base/gnome-common-2.20.0 USE="-debug" 63 kB
[ebuild N ] gnome-base/gnome-mime-data-2.18.0 USE="-debug" 593 kB
[ebuild NS ] sys-devel/automake-1.8.5-r3 648 kB
[ebuild N ] app-text/libspectre-0.2.1 USE="-debug -doc -test" 381 kB
[ebuild NS ] sys-devel/automake-1.5 515 kB
[ebuild N ] gnome-base/gail-1.22.3 USE="-debug -doc" 659 kB
[ebuild N ] dev-perl/XML-LibXML-Common-0.13 13 kB
[ebuild N ] app-text/scrollkeeper-dtd-1.0 11 kB
[ebuild N ] app-text/rarian-0.8.1 USE="-debug" 317 kB
[ebuild N ] gnome-base/gconf-2.22.0 USE="-debug -doc -ldap" 1,384 kB
[ebuild N ] dev-libs/dbus-glib-0.76 USE="-debug -doc (-selinux)" 652 kB
[ebuild N ] app-text/sgml-common-0.6.3-r5 75 kB
[ebuild N ] app-text/docbook-xsl-stylesheets-1.73.2 1,636 kB
[ebuild N ] gnome-base/libgnomecanvas-2.20.1.1 USE="X -debug -doc" 570 kB
[ebuild N ] dev-perl/XML-SAX-0.16 59 kB
[ebuild N ] virtual/perl-Test-Simple-0.80 0 kB
[ebuild N ] virtual/perl-Storable-2.18 0 kB
[ebuild N ] app-text/scrollkeeper-9999-r1 0 kB
[ebuild N ] gnome-base/gnome-vfs-2.22.0 USE="acl gnutls ipv6 ssl -avahi -debug -doc -fam -hal -kerberos -samba" 1,895 kB
[ebuild N ] gnome-base/libbonobo-2.24.0 USE="-debug -doc" 1,422 kB
[ebuild N ] app-text/docbook-xml-dtd-4.4-r1 94 kB
[ebuild N ] app-text/docbook-xml-dtd-4.1.2-r6 74 kB
[ebuild N ] gnome-base/gnome-keyring-2.22.3 USE="pam -debug -doc -hal -test" 874 kB
[ebuild N ] dev-perl/XML-LibXML-1.66-r1 271 kB
[ebuild N ] gnome-base/libgnome-2.22.0 USE="-debug -doc -esd" 1,375 kB
[ebuild N ] app-text/gnome-doc-utils-0.12.2-r1 USE="-debug" 582 kB
[ebuild N ] dev-perl/XML-Simple-2.18 70 kB
[ebuild N ] gnome-base/libbonoboui-2.22.0 USE="X -debug -doc" 983 kB
[ebuild N ] x11-misc/icon-naming-utils-0.8.6 68 kB
[ebuild N ] x11-themes/gnome-icon-theme-2.22.0 USE="-debug" 3,581 kB
[ebuild N ] gnome-base/libgnomeui-2.22.1 USE="jpeg -debug -doc" 1,417 kB
[ebuild N ] app-text/evince-2.22.2-r1 USE="djvu tiff -dbus -debug -doc -dvi -gnome -gnome-keyring -t1lib" 1,592 kB

Total: 38 packages (36 new, 2 in new slots Size of downloads: 24,376 kB

А этот что-то много всего хочет... и главное как-то все из гнома.. несмотря на флаг -gnome:confused:
И dbus ему нахрена нужен? :mad:

Bibi

мне очень нравится okular

dangerr

А этот от kde-libs зависит... :(

Bibi

да. у меня они только ради него и лежат

dangerr

Ясно.... но это только на крайний случай... сейчас нашел epdfview, он вроде по-лучше xpdf, но тоже не умеет континиус вью (не нашел по крайней мере) и сегфолтится при нажатии на клавиши курсора.

dangerr

Сегфолтился по моей вине, сейчас все ок. Буду пользоваться им.

hwh2010

вроде бывает evince-gtk, который не требует гномьих либ
по крайней мере в убунте и дебиане такой пакет существует

serega1604

требует он гномьи либы, но только в меньших количествах.
скорость света от лампочки гентуиста на 6 процентов больше

Serab

Пользовался долгое время, пока не наткнулся на следующую проблему: при печати не всего документа, а начиная с некоторой страницы печатает так называетмые кракозябры (еще в интернетах встречается термин кракозяблы).

Andbar

сегфолтится при нажатии на клавиши курсора.
это никак нельзя назвать
Сегфолтился по моей вине
Как правило подобные случаи вызваны непредусмотрительностью разработчиков :smirk:

dangerr

http://trac.emma-soft.com/epdfview/
The aim of ePDFView is to make a simple PDF document viewer, in the lines of Evince but without using the Gnome libraries.
Это не одно и то же случаем?

hwh2010

Это не одно и то же случаем?
не одно. установил epdfview, c первого взгляда показалось менее удобно

dangerr

ну у меня принтер LPT, а LPT на ноуте нет, так что в /etc/make.conf присутсвует "-cups" => эти проблемы мне не важны... а если что, буду печатать через xpdf

dangerr

Нет, явно не по их. Я перед установкой epdfview поставил новый gcc (помеченный как нестабильный) и он почему-то криво все компилил. Пересобрал со старым и оказалось все ок. В причине почему он все компилил криво предстоит разобраться потом...

dangerr

возможно... но независимость от всяких тормозных DE все же говорит в пользу epdfview. Единственное, что в нем мне не хватает как я уже сказал - continuous view.

conv3rsje

Зря ты так на evince
Для ознакомления депы от evince-gtk

Depends: libatk1.0-0 (>= 1.20.0 libc6 (>= 2.7-1 libcairo2 (>= 1.6.0 libdbus-1-3 (>= 1.0.2 libdbus-glib-1-2 (>= 0.71
libdjvulibre21 (>= 3.5.20 libgcc1 (>= 1:4.1.1 libgconf2-4 (>= 2.13.5 libglade2-0 (>= 1:2.6.1 libglib2.0-0 (>= 2.16.0
libgnome-keyring0 (>= 2.22.0 libgtk2.0-0 (>= 2.12.0 libjpeg62, libkpathsea4 (>= 2007 libpango1.0-0 (>= 1.20.3 libpoppler-glib3,
libspectre1, libstdc++6 (>= 4.1.1 libtiff4, libx11-6, libxml2 (>= 2.6.27 zlib1g (>= 1:1.1.4 gconf2 (>= 2.10.1-2
gnome-icon-theme (>= 2.17.1 shared-mime-info

У тебя вытягиваются депы от evince ( назовем его evince-gnome)

Depends: libart-2.0-2 (>= 2.3.18 libatk1.0-0 (>= 1.20.0 libbonobo2-0 (>= 2.15.0 libbonoboui2-0 (>= 2.15.1 libc6 (>= 2.7-1
libcairo2 (>= 1.6.0 libdbus-1-3 (>= 1.0.2 libdbus-glib-1-2 (>= 0.71 libdjvulibre21 (>= 3.5.20 libgcc1 (>= 1:4.1.1
libgconf2-4 (>= 2.13.5 libglade2-0 (>= 1:2.6.1 libglib2.0-0 (>= 2.16.0 libgnome-keyring0 (>= 2.22.0 libgnome2-0 (>= 2.17.3
libgnomecanvas2-0 (>= 2.11.1 libgnomeui-0 (>= 2.17.1 libgnomevfs2-0 (>= 1:2.17.90 libgtk2.0-0 (>= 2.12.0 libice6 (>= 1:1.0.0
libjpeg62, libkpathsea4 (>= 2007 libnautilus-extension1 (>= 2.17.90 liborbit2 (>= 1:2.14.10 libpango1.0-0 (>= 1.20.3
libpoppler-glib3, libpopt0 (>= 1.14 libsm6, libspectre1, libstdc++6 (>= 4.1.1 libtiff4, libx11-6, libxml2 (>= 2.6.27
zlib1g (>= 1:1.1.4 gconf2 (>= 2.10.1-2 gnome-icon-theme (>= 2.17.1 shared-mime-info

Что из зависимостей evince-gtk относится к "тормознутой DE"?
дбус сейчас используется очень и очень активно, лишним уж точно не будет, чай не сервер. По крайней мере лично мне система с хал + дбус понравилась
gconf разве что... Но это просто куча хмлников и скрипты для работы с ними.

BondarAndrey

а то xpdf не умеет показывать страницы в "continuous view"
И как давно он это разучился делать? xpdf -cont my.pdf или правой кнопкой мыши и выбрать нужный пункт меню.
$ xpdf -v
xpdf version 3.02
Copyright 1996-2007 Glyph & Cog, LLC

dangerr

boolean / # emerge -s evince
Searching...
[ Results for search key : evince ]
[ Applications found : 1 ]

* app-text/evince
Latest version available: 2.22.2-r1
Latest version installed: [ Not Installed ]
Size of files: 1,591 kB
Homepage: http://www.gnome.org/projects/evince/
Description: Simple document viewer for GNOME
License: GPL-2

не вижу никаких других эвинсов. Только разве если его собрать с "-gnome" это не будет то же самое, что evince-gtk?
с "gnome" у меня ставятся 45 пакетов, тогда как с "-gnome" - 36
Для ознакомления депы от evince-gtk

Так они же от опций сборки зависят... так что какой смысл в этом?
Что из зависимостей evince-gtk относится к "тормознутой DE"?

boolean / # emerge -pv evince | grep gnome
[ebuild N ] gnome-base/orbit-2.14.13 USE="-debug -doc" 723 kB
[ebuild N ] gnome-base/gnome-common-2.20.0 USE="-debug" 63 kB
[ebuild N ] gnome-base/gnome-mime-data-2.18.0 USE="-debug" 593 kB
[ebuild N ] gnome-base/gail-1.22.3 USE="-debug -doc" 659 kB
[ebuild N ] gnome-base/gconf-2.22.0 USE="-debug -doc -ldap" 1,384 kB
[ebuild N ] gnome-base/libgnomecanvas-2.20.1.1 USE="X -debug -doc" 570 kB
[ebuild N ] gnome-base/gnome-vfs-2.22.0 USE="acl gnutls ipv6 ssl -avahi -debug -doc -fam -hal -kerberos -samba" 1,895 kB
[ebuild N ] gnome-base/libbonobo-2.24.0 USE="-debug -doc" 1,422 kB
[ebuild N ] gnome-base/gnome-keyring-2.22.3 USE="pam -debug -doc -hal -test" 874 kB
[ebuild N ] gnome-base/libgnome-2.22.0 USE="-debug -doc -esd" 1,375 kB
[ebuild N ] app-text/gnome-doc-utils-0.12.2-r1 USE="-debug" 582 kB
[ebuild N ] gnome-base/libbonoboui-2.22.0 USE="X -debug -doc" 983 kB
[ebuild N ] x11-themes/gnome-icon-theme-2.22.0 USE="-debug" 3,581 kB
[ebuild N ] gnome-base/libgnomeui-2.22.1 USE="jpeg -debug -doc" 1,417 kB

дбус сейчас используется очень и очень активно, лишним уж точно не будет, чай не сервер. По крайней мере лично мне система с хал + дбус понравилась

Я почтал о дбасе на википедии... понял как он устроен, как работает и для чего сделан (для некоего "взаимодействия" приложений). Только вот я так и не смог понять какой мне в этом прок на практике...
Просвяти пожалуйста, для чего dbus + hal можно использовать практически?

spitfire

Просвяти пожалуйста, для чего dbus + hal можно использовать практически?
Юзерспэйсовая организация обработки втыкаемых в систему девайсов с разграничением по правам.

conv3rsje

Просвяти пожалуйста, для чего dbus + hal можно использовать практически?
С точки зрения пользователя ion'а - наверно никаких :)
Хотя и ему тоже... Например, в X.org 1.5 по умолчанию конфигурация устройств берется именно из хала. Вместе с RandR получается полноценные иксы с пустым конфигом.
Из пользовательских - всякие автомонтирования и прочая лабуда. Тот же NetworkManager (якорь ему в печень) их хала кормится, avahi (mdns сервер).
ЗЫ Здесь и далее поведение пакетов описывается применительно к дебиану, в генте могут быть другие умолчания
ЗЗЫ evince-gtk - это дебиановский пакет, собранный без гномовских зависимостей.

dangerr

Спасибо! Насчет правой кнопки мыши я правда не понял... но xpdf -cont my.pdf действительно работает.... оказывается это еще и man-е написано... забылся я как-то, что у gui-приложений тоже могут быть опции и маны :)
Может еще можно его с юникодом подружить, заменить панельку выбора открываемого файла и показывать\убирать с помощью клавиатуры боковую панельку с оглавлением (в секции Key bindings мана я такого не нашел)?
upd: дошло про правую кнопку :)

dangerr

Про хал понятно, мне он не нужен, хотя действительно многим может быть полезен - пусть живет :grin:
А dbus какую пользу приносит? У меня вот только одна мысль - Drag'n'Drop...

kokto

code:boolean / # emerge -s acrobat
Searching...
[ Results for search key : acrobat ]
[ Applications found : 0 ]
нету такого...
acroread называется

conv3rsje

Хал без него не может, он по нему всем рассказывает интересные новости
Кроме другндропа по дбусу бегает еще, например, gnome-keyring (то что навскидку вспомнил, не пинай что gnome-*).
Из достойных примеров использования - telepathy

BondarAndrey

Может еще можно его с юникодом подружить, заменить панельку выбора открываемого файла и показывать\убирать с помощью клавиатуры боковую панельку с оглавлением (в секции Key bindings мана я такого не нашел)?
Не, это вроде родовое. Motif (или lesstif, всегда их путаю) с юникодом не дружит. В смысле, совсем никак.

dangerr

Спасибо за ликбес :)
Я в общем так понял, что все же dbus имеет смысл использовать при использовании DE

dangerr

Жалко... В таком случае его стоит выкинуть на свалку истории
Оставить комментарий
Имя или ник:
Комментарий: